The Mechanism Of How Supervisor Ostracism Impacts On Subordinates' Work Engagement

Workplace Ostracism is a research topic which has attracted much attention from Chinese and Western scholars in recent years.Supervision Ostracism is a kind of workplace ostracism directly from superiors,which plays an important role in employees' mental state,organizational attitude,organizational behavior and organizational performance.At the individual level,supervision ostracism negatively affect employees' mental and physical health and work behavior.At the organizational level,supervisor ostracism has negative effects on subordinates' help behavior,organizational citizenship behavior,organizational trust and organizational performance and so on.Leaders are people who have the most contact with employees except colleagues.They are the incarnation and spokesmen of organizations.They are the links between employees and organizations.The relationship between leaders and subordinates is very important for individual and organizational performance.The purpose of this study is to explore the relationship between supervision ostracism and subordinates' trust in leader and work engagement,and the mechanism of power distance and leader justice in this process.This research employed empirical research methods through the questionnaire survey,and collected 244 valid samples.Through SPSS20.0 and Amos 22.0 software to demonstrate and analyze hypotheses.Through the study,we find that:(1)Leaders who actualize supervision ostracism can reduce subordinates' trust in leader;(2)To a certain extent,leaders actualizing supervision ostracism also have negative impact on the work engagement of employee;(3)Subordinates' trust in leader contributes to the improvement of work engagement;(4)The relationship between supervision ostracism and subordinates' trust in leader is totally mediated by leader justice support;(5)The relationship between supervision ostracism and subordinates' work engagement is partially mediated by leader justice support;(6)Power distance negatively moderates the relationship between supervision ostracism and leader justice.Finally,based on the conclusions and management practice,this paper puts forward suggestions for further research.
